WebMar 29, 2024 · Consider noise-blocking curtains to cut down on street noise. You can also use a fan or white noise machine to drown out unpredictable or distracting sounds. Light Level: Start dimming indoor lights as bedtime approaches, and keep your child’s bedroom as dark as possible. This promotes healthy levels of melatonin.

Also available as an e-book. ourstage incWebMar 2, 2024 · Sensitive teeth: Children who grind their teeth may be more sensitive to hot or cold food and drinks. Jaw pain or headaches: Constant pressure from clenched teeth may result in headaches, jaw pain, and occasionally clicking sounds or increased size of the jaw muscles.
